Bear in mind I’ve only evaluated one basenji litter and I prefer hands on evalution but based on these pictures…
I like the red better. He seems a bit overangulated at this age but he might grow out of that. Probably longer than “truly square” but many basenjis are. He has a nice level topline and a smoother transition of neck to shoulders than the other puppy. He draws my eye.
The brindle has a weaker topline and I don’t like the rear assembly. I think it may be that the hocks too long which are giving his rear a straighter appearance. He does look more square than the red so that’s a plus. He has some nice attributes but all things considered I would still prefer the red.
